SAP BICS_CONS_EXECUTE_PLANNING_SEQ Function Module for Execute Planning Sequence
BICS_CONS_EXECUTE_PLANNING_SEQ is a standard bics cons execute planning seq SAP function module available within SAP R/3 or S/4 Hana systems, depending on your version and release level. Function Group: RSBOLAP_BICS_CONSUMER
Program Name: SAPLRSBOLAP_BICS_CONSUMER
Main Program: SAPLRSBOLAP_BICS_CONSUMER
Appliation area:
Release date: N/A
Mode(Normal, Remote etc): Remote-Enabled

Function BICS_CONS_EXECUTE_PLANNING_SEQ pattern details
In-order to call this FM within your sap programs, simply using the below ABAP pattern details to trigger the function call...or see the full ABAP code listing at the end of this article. You can simply cut and paste this code into your ABAP progrom as it is, including variable declarations.CALL FUNCTION 'BICS_CONS_EXECUTE_PLANNING_SEQ'"Execute Planning Sequence.
EXPORTING
I_SEQUENCE_HANDLE = "Unique Object Handle for External Communication
* I_PROCESS_CHANGED_DATA = "Boolean
* I_AGGREGATION_LEVEL = "InfoProvider
* I_REUSE = RS_C_FALSE "Reuse Planning Sequence
IMPORTING
E_MAX_MESSAGE_TYPE = "Message Type
E_EXECUTED = "Planning Function Executed
E_DATA_AREA_CONTAINS_DATA = "Data Area Contains Data
TABLES
* E_T_MESSAGE = "Message
* I_T_STATISTIC_INFO = "OLAP Statistics: Mass Insert of Event Data
* E_T_OUT_OF_SYNC_DP = "Object Name as Structure for RFC
EXCEPTIONS
INVALID_SEQUENCE_HANDLE = 1 VARIABLE_INPUT_NECESSARY = 2
IMPORTING Parameters details for BICS_CONS_EXECUTE_PLANNING_SEQ
I_SEQUENCE_HANDLE - Unique Object Handle for External Communication
Data type: RSBOLAP_HANDLEOptional: No
Call by Reference: No ( called with pass by value option)
I_PROCESS_CHANGED_DATA - Boolean
Data type: RS_BOOLOptional: Yes
Call by Reference: No ( called with pass by value option)
I_AGGREGATION_LEVEL - InfoProvider
Data type: RSINFOPROVOptional: Yes
Call by Reference: No ( called with pass by value option)
I_REUSE - Reuse Planning Sequence
Data type: RS_BOOLDefault: RS_C_FALSE
Optional: Yes
Call by Reference: No ( called with pass by value option)
EXPORTING Parameters details for BICS_CONS_EXECUTE_PLANNING_SEQ
E_MAX_MESSAGE_TYPE - Message Type
Data type: SYMSGTYOptional: No
Call by Reference: No ( called with pass by value option)
E_EXECUTED - Planning Function Executed
Data type: RS_BOOLOptional: No
Call by Reference: No ( called with pass by value option)
E_DATA_AREA_CONTAINS_DATA - Data Area Contains Data
Data type: RS_BOOLOptional: No
Call by Reference: No ( called with pass by value option)
TABLES Parameters details for BICS_CONS_EXECUTE_PLANNING_SEQ
E_T_MESSAGE - Message
Data type: BICS_PROV_MESSAGEOptional: Yes
Call by Reference: No ( called with pass by value option)
I_T_STATISTIC_INFO - OLAP Statistics: Mass Insert of Event Data
Data type: RSSTA_S_EVENTINPUTOptional: Yes
Call by Reference: No ( called with pass by value option)
E_T_OUT_OF_SYNC_DP - Object Name as Structure for RFC
Data type: RSBOLAP_S_OBJECT_NAMEOptional: Yes
Call by Reference: No ( called with pass by value option)
EXCEPTIONS details
INVALID_SEQUENCE_HANDLE - Invalid Planning Sequence Handle
Data type:Optional: No
Call by Reference: Yes
VARIABLE_INPUT_NECESSARY - Variable Entry Required
Data type:Optional: No
Call by Reference: No ( called with pass by value option)
